Courts in Hoke County

There are 2 Courts in Hoke County, North Carolina, serving a population of 52,571 people in an area of 391 square miles. There is 1 Court per 26,285 people, and 1 Court per 195 square miles.

In North Carolina, Hoke County is ranked 54th of 100 counties in Courts per capita, and 39th of 100 counties in Courts per square mile.

About Hoke County Courts

Courts in Hoke County, NC are government institutions that resolve legal disputes in accordance with local Hoke County and North Carolina law and are housed in Hoke County courthouses. Courts are divided into Criminal Courts and Civil Courts. In Hoke County Criminal Courts, the government prosecutes a case against parties accused of breaking the law. In Hoke County Civil Courts the Court resolves disputes between citizens.
